2013-09-11 6 views
1

드롭 다운 값을 저장할 때 Kendo Grid에서 중복 데이터 입력을 필터링해야합니다.Kendo Grid에서 값을 동일하게 입력하는 것을 방지하는 방법

나는이 요일을 표시 드롭 다운 예를 들어 월요일, 화요일 등

에가하지만 난 삭제하지 않는 한 이전에 저장되는 일을 저장하는 사용자를 방지 할 메시지를 보여줌으로써이 문제를 방지하려면 그것. 누군가이 상황을 도와 줄 수 있습니까 ?? Viewbag에 대한

<p> 
       <label for="dllAvailableDay"> 
        <abbr title="This is a required field."> 
         <em><font color="red">*</font></em></abbr> 
        Available Day</label> 
       <span> 
        @Html.DropDownList("dllAvailableDay", new SelectList(ViewBag.availableDayList, "ID", "Display_Value", workerAvailableDay), "[Please Select]", 
      new Dictionary<string, object> 
       { 
        {"class","validate[required] inputLong"} 
       }) 
       </span> 
      </p> 

컨트롤러 :

드롭 다운 목록 내

private void GetAvailableDayList() 
     { 
      var availableDayList = (from a in db.Lookups 
            where a.Domain == "AVAILABLEDAY" 
            select a).ToList(); 

      ViewBag.AvailableDayList = availableDayList; 
     } 

감사합니다.

답변

0

자바 스크립트에서 '사용 일수'목록을 가지고 푸시 앤 팝을 사용하고 더 이상 사용하지 않을 경우 제거 할 수 있습니다. 그런 다음 해당 배열을 사용하여 선택 유효성을 검사합니다 (드롭 다운에 선택 이벤트 추가).

관련 문제